WATCH: Glenvista High School gets great prizes in SARB competition

Nompilo Oha, Thembelihle Mbatha, Gugulethu Mkhonza, and Ntwanonhle Myeni put Glenvista High on the map after getting fifth place in the 2024 Monetary Policy Committee (MPC) Schools Challenge.

Glenvista High School learners made their school proud when they placed in fifth position and walked away with great prizes in the 2024 Monetary Policy Committee (MPC) Schools Challenge.

The South African Reserve Bank (SARB), in collaboration with the Department of Basic Education (DBE), announced the winners of the 2024 Monetary Policy Committee (MPC) Schools Challenge at the Sandton Convention Centre’s Bill Gallagher Room.

Glenvista High School was among the 12 schools shortlisted as finalists for the MPC Schools Challenge. The learners delivered a well-prepared presentation during the presentation stage of the competition at Irene Country Lodge in Centurion on August 6.

Nompilo Oha, Thembelihle Mbatha, Ntwanonhle Myeni, and Gugulethu Mkhonza represented the school.

The learners walked away with R9 000 each and a certificate. Their teacher received a laptop, and the school took home R16 000.
